G. Lepoutre is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Catalysis and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, G. Lepoutre has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 355 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Materials Chemistry, 9 papers in Catalysis and 7 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in G. Lepoutre's work include Ammonia Synthesis and Nitrogen Reduction (9 papers),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(7 papers) and Thermodynamic properties of mixtures (4 papers). G. Lepoutre is often cited by papers focused on Ammonia Synthesis and Nitrogen Reduction (9 papers),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(7 papers) and Thermodynamic properties of mixtures (4 papers). G. Lepoutre collaborates with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and United States. G. Lepoutre's co-authors include J. P. Lelieur, J. F. Dewald, Philippe Dúbois, Joshua Jortner, A. Demortier, Paul Rigny, E. Duval, Pamela J. Schettler, P. Damay and James C. Thompson and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, The Journal of Chemical Physics and Journal of The Electrochemical Society.
